Switching input signal

The projector can be connected to multiple devices
at the same time. However, it can only display one
full screen at a time. When starting up, the projector
automatically searches for the available signals.
Be sure the Advanced menu - Display > Auto Source
Search is On if you want the projector to
automatically search for the signals.
To manually select the source:
1. Press
. A source selection bar appears.
2. Press
/ until your desired signal is selected
and press OK.
Once detected, the picture from the selected source will appear. If there is multiple
equipment connected to the projector, repeat steps 1-2 to search for another signal.
• The brightness level of the projected image will change accordingly when you switch between different
input signals.
• For best display picture results, you should select and use an input signal which outputs at the
projector's native resolution. Any other resolutions will be scaled by the projector depending upon the
